    Laba is beautiful before Prague. Podebrady was a nice town for me. After Nymburk, some parts of the route are… singletrack. But you should have no issues with those tires.

    Entrance to Prague is nice, bike paths everywhere. But I didn’t enjoy my evening and night in Prague, simply too touristy.

    After Prague the EV7 is nice, althoug I got bored a bit. Just riding along the river for a few days… I wanted something different, so I turned to the hills at Melnik. That detour was very nice for me, away from the people, went through Česka Lipa and Chrybska. Then rejoined the EV7 before entering Germany.

    And, sorry to have to say that, didn’t feel much love in Germany before reaching Dresden. The approach to Dresden is really nice.
